Historical & Cultural Background
The name Iziah is derived from the Hebrew name Yeshayahu, which translates to "Yahweh is salvation." The name has undergone various transformations through linguistic and cultural exchanges. The Hebrew root 'yesha' means "to save" or "to deliver," which is foundational to the name's meaning.

The English form, Isaiah, became widely recognized through biblical texts, particularly in the King James Bible published in 1611, which features the Book of Isaiah, attributed to the prophet Isaiah, a significant figure in Jewish and Christian traditions.
Historically, Isaiah is noted as one of the major prophets in the Hebrew Bible, active in the 8th century BCE. His prophecies addressed the Kingdom of Judah during a time of political turmoil and moral decline, emphasizing themes of justice, redemption, and the coming of a messianic age.
The influence of Isaiah's writings has been profound, shaping theological concepts in both Judaism and Christianity. His name has been borne by various notable figures throughout history, including saints and religious leaders, further embedding it in cultural and religious contexts.
Culturally, the name Iziah, along with its variants, carries connotations of hope and divine intervention, resonating with the themes of salvation and deliverance inherent in its etymology. The name has been associated with strength and resilience due to its biblical roots.
Diminutive forms like Izzy may also be used, reflecting a more informal or affectionate variant of the name. Overall, the name Iziah encapsulates a rich historical and linguistic heritage, reflecting its enduring significance across cultures and eras.

U.S. Historical Usage
The name Iziah was first seen in the United States in 1921.
Iziah has ranked as high as #1320 nationally, which occurred in 2008, and has been most popular in Texas, California, New York, Florida, and Illinois.
In the past 5 years the name Iziah has been trending up compared to the previous 5 years.
